HD74LVC16244A 16-bit Buffers / Line Drivers with 3-state Outputs ADE-205-119B(Z) 3rd Edition Decemver 1996 Description The HD74LVC16244A has sixteen line drivers with three state outputs in a 48 pin package. This device is a non inverting buffer and has two active low enables (1 G to 4G). Each enable independently controls four buffers. Low voltage and high speed operation is suitable at the battery drive product (note type personal computer) and low power consumption extends the life of a battery for long time operation.
